Credit Repair Tips And Tricks

Author : Devora Witts


         


Having credit issues can be extremely tiresome and very frustrating, to say the least. Most of the times, it is difficult to identify the financial mistakes you make and which have led to you having a bad credit score and history. And even if you do identify them, there is no guarantee you will not make them again if you do not know better. Most resort to credit repair agencies and counseling, which is a great solution but may turn out to be pricy. What is the point in having someone fix your credit if you will have to get deeper in debt to do so?

Most people do not know that credit fixing is no science. There is nothing a credit repair agency will do that you cannot do yourself with some time and patience. Now, if what you want is not to make an effort, and you can pay to have someone do that effort in your place, then go for it! But if it is not your case (and I am guessing it is not, otherwise you would not be reading this article), then read on to find an easy guide to do-it-yourself credit repair.

Do-It-Yourself Tip #1: New Financial Life Implies New Lifestyle

I know this might not be of your liking, but in order to achieve a successful credit repair, you must change your bad financial habits. Otherwise, you will just fix your financial standing momentarily. We are not looking for band aids here, but for fully-fledged surgery.

My best piece of advice for you would be to research online for a guide to budgeting and a guide to saving (though one thing invariably leads to the other), I have written some of them myself. Before you even attempt to start repairing your credit, bear in mind that this lifestyle change cannot last months, or a couple of years, it is a lifetime commitment. It sounds horrible, but once you get used to it, it is nowhere near as terrible as it sounds. No pain, no gain, right?

Do-It-Yourself Tip #2: Check Out Your Report And Correct It

You should always have an updated copy of your credit report handy. Knowing your credit score by heart is not only not enough but also useless. By periodically checking your credit report, you can have a more detailed knowledge of what is going on in your financial life and, most importantly, what is evidently failing. What I recommend all my customers is to check their credit files for errors once every six months. Sometimes you will find inaccuracies which might be unfairly bringing your credit score down. These inaccuracies can and must be corrected.

Take into account that negative but accurate inputs cannot be removed. Do not believe anyone claiming they can make it happen, because they are lying. Scam alert!

Do-It-Yourself Tip #3: Consider Applying For A Consolidation Loan

If you are deep in debt and simply cannot pay your debt back, then it will be wise of you to apply for a consolidation loan as soon as possible. Once you have the money on your hands, pay back your debts and begin repaying the consolidation loan. Request the longest term possible so as to have more affordable monthly payments.

Do-It-Yourself Tip #4: Repay Bills And Loans In A Timely Manner

Once your major debt is gone, begin repaying your bills and the monthly installments on the loan as timely as possible. This will begin to reflect on your credit report soon, and your credit score will rise consequently.
